Troubleshooting Parameters
41-001343-02 REV04 – 05.2014 A-222
Parameters –
log module <module name>
Configuration Files
aastra.cfg, <model>.cfg, <mac>.cfg
Description Allows enhanced severity filtering of log calls sent as blog output.
The blog, as used on the IP phones, is a an online debugging tool that can be frequently
updated and intended for technical support analysis. Blogs are defined by their format: a
series of entries posted to a single page in reverse-chronological order. The IP Phone
blogs are separated into modules which allow you to log specific information for analyz-
ing:
Module Name (configuration files)
• linemgr (line manager information)
• user interface
• misc (miscellaneous)
• sip (call control SIP stack)
• dis (display driver)
• dstore (delayed storage)
• ept (endpoint)
• ind (indicator)
• kbd (keyboard)
• net (network)
• provis (provisioning)
• rtpt (Real Time Transport)
• snd (sound)
• prof (profiler)
• xml (Extension Markup Language)
• stun (Simple Traversal of User Datagram Protocol (UDP) through Network Address
Translation (NAT)
• lldp (Link Layer Discovery Protocol)
• bluetooth (6739i only)
Format Integer
Default Value 1 (fatal errors)
Range
Debug Level Value
Fatal Errors 1 (default)
Errors 2
Warnings 4
Init 8
Functions 16
Info 32
All debug levels
OFF
0
All Debug Levels
ON
65535
